2nd Story Counseling is a Chicago-based psychotherapy practice established in 2005, located at 655 W. Irving Park Road, Suite 204, in the Lakeview neighborhood, Illinois 60613. Over nearly two decades, the practice has served North Side communities including Lakeview, Uptown, Andersonville, Lincoln Park, Edgewater, Avondale, and Wrigleyville. The site describes the practice as solution-focused, compassionate, and interactive in its clinical approach.

The clinical team includes more than ten specialist therapists comprising psychologists, licensed social workers, and counselors. Staff hold training or faculty affiliations with the University of Illinois, Yale University, Princeton University, and the New York Institute of Technology. Several clinicians openly identify as gay, lesbian, bisexual, or queer, and the practice describes itself as LGBTQ+ Affirming across all services. The team serves a wide range of client backgrounds and mental health concerns.

Therapeutic modalities available at the practice include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), Solution-Focused Therapy, Exposure and Response Prevention (ERP), Internal Family Systems (IFS),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R), Cognitive Processing Therapy (CPT), and mindfulness-based approaches. Services encompass individual therapy, couples and family counseling, and psychological and neuropsychological testing for ADHD and learning disabilities.

Specializations span anxiety, depression, trauma and PTSD, grief and loss, anger management, obsessive-compulsive disorder, ADHD, life transitions, relationship issues, and social anxiety. Populations served include men, women, college students, young adults, adolescents, LGBTQ+ individuals, and highly sensitive persons. The practice notes its clinicians take an interactive, engaged role in the therapeutic process rather than a passive or directive-only approach.

Sessions are available in person at the Lakeview office and via secure telehealth throughout Illinois. Blue Cross Blue Shield PPO insurance is accepted.
